Ww Strawberry Spinach Salad

We enjoyed this simple low cal salad which is great with grilled fish or chicken or even by itself for a low cal lunch. Recipe source: Great Cooking Every Day If you are following Weight Watchers this is 3 points per serving.

ingredients
- 1 tablespoon cider vinegar
- 2 teaspoons vegetable oil (I used olive oil)
- 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
- 1⁄2 teaspoon honey
- 1 pinch rosemary
- pepper
- 1 (10 ounce) bag spinach, rinsed and torn
- 2 cups strawberries, hulled and halved
- 1⁄4 onion, thinly sliced
- 2⁄3 cup aged goat cheese, crumbled
directions
- In a large salad bowl whisk together the dressing ingredients (vinegar - pepper).
- Add the spinach, strawberries and onion. Toss.
- Sprinkle with the cheese. Toss.
